This site uses cookies to store information on your local computer. By continuing to browse the site, you are agreeing to our use of cookies. close

Stickers

There are 127 products.

Showing 1-99 of 127 item(s)

Active filters

  • Categories: Featured Brands
  • Brand: Montesa
  • Brand: Moto Guzzi